Tree Inspections An arboricultural survey is very important to record trees that may be at risk of causing harm or damage, in both residential and commercial circumstances. It is the tree-owner’s legal ‘duty of care’ to others to have their trees professionally inspected and the recommended work carried out. The survey provides information such as: Tree species, age and condition Potential safety concerns, hazards or nuisances Prioritised recommendations for remedial work BS5837/Pre-Planning Surveys Working from a CAD-type drawing with accurate tree locations, BS5837 surveys are designed to collect accurate data for each tree, assess their condition and categorise them according to their quality, which is based on condition, and their arboricultural, ecological and cultural significance. The survey includes a full stock-take of trees in areas that may be affected by a proposed development, recording all relevant dimensions and tree condition. A full report detailing tree condition with recommended works, potential conflicts and a tree constraints plan (showing root protection areas) is provided. If required by planning, we can also provide an Arboricultural Impact Assessment, Arboricultural Method Statement and a Tree Protection Plan. Inspections For Bats In Trees Wilful or negligent destruction of bats or their roosts is a criminal offence. Bats are a threatened species, with their habitat being severely depleted over the last century. They are a necessary and important part of our natural ecology, responsible for keeping down the numbers of midges and other flying insects. We can carry out ground-based ‘bat potential’ inspections as well as more thorough ground- and aerial-inspections of trees for bats using an endoscope.
